9. Decoding Protocols

9.1 Introduction

Merlin can decode HCI, LMP and L2CAP messages, and RFCOMM, SDP,
TCS, HDLC, PPP, OBEX, HCRP, BNEP, HID, IP, TCP, and UDP
protocols. The default is packet level decoding, which means that baseband
packets will be displayed when you first view a trace. If these packets are
carrying LMP, L2CAP or other protocols, the protocols will display as
undecoded fields such as the L2CAP packet below.

By issuing a decode command, Merlin can decode these LMP and other
fields and display the data in summary statements called LMP/L2CAP
Messages
, Protocol Messages, and Protocol Transactions.
